Citations
3 citations on file for this inspection.
1910.178 L01 I
- Issued
- Abate by
- Penalty
- Initial $3326.00 · Current $1663.00 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.178(l)(1)(i): The employer did not ensure that each powered industrial truck operator is competent to operate a powered industrial truck safely, as demonstrated by the successful completion of the training and evaluation specified in this paragraph (l): Employees at the construction site were exposed to struck by hazards in that the operator of the fork truck was allowed to operate the equipment with out first receiving a combination of formal and practical training.

1926.20 B01
- Issued
- Abate by
- Penalty
- Initial $3326.00 · Current $1663.00 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.20(b)(1): The employer did not initiate and maintain such programs as may be necessary to comply with this part Temporary employees working at the residential construction site were exposed to falls hazards and struck-by hazards in that the employer had not developed and implemented a comprehensive safety and health program.

1926.501 B13
- Issued
- Abate by
- Penalty
- Initial $2772.00 · Current $1386.00 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b): Employees engaged in construction cleanup activities were exposed to a fall hazards of approximately 20 feet from an elevated balcony to the ground below in that fall protection was not provided and used while accessing the balcony to load a forklift with trash.
